Output 6f305cd673319499a0defcd54569d6e66d1e3fff9bbe34704427678cc1be53e7:1

value
557009
script pubkey
OP_0 OP_PUSHBYTES_20 e25f5986c098e9f4c7de0351569ef30ab7b231b8
address
bc1quf04npkqnr5lf377qdg4d8hnp2mmyvdce0pfs3
transaction
6f305cd673319499a0defcd54569d6e66d1e3fff9bbe34704427678cc1be53e7
confirmations
311883
spent
true